/* This style sheet was produced, arranged, composed and performed by Yisrael */a:link 		{ color:#d1c898; }a:active 	{ color:#d1c898; }a:visited 	{ color:#979797; }/* border lines galore */.border {	padding-top: 2px;	padding-bottom: 2px;	border: solid 1px black;	font-family: Arial, Lucida Grande, Helvetica, sans-serif;	font-size: 14px;	color: white;	line-height: 18px}.imageborder {	border-top: solid 1px #393737;	border-left: solid 1px #393737;	border-right: solid 1px #393737;}.imagebox {	border-left: solid 1px #0d0d0d;	border-bottom: solid 1px #0d0d0d;	border-right: solid 1px #0d0d0d}.cella {	border-left: solid 1px #e5e5e5;	border-bottom: solid 1px #e5e5e5;	border-right: solid 1px #e5e5e5;	font-family: Trebuchet MS, Trebuchet;	font-size: 11px;	line-height: 14px}.cellb {	padding-top: 8px;	padding-bottom: 8px;	padding-left: 8px;	border-bottom: solid 1px #e5e5e5;	border-right: solid 1px #e5e5e5;	font-family: Trebuchet MS, Trebuchet;	font-size: 11px;	line-height: 14px}.fullbox {	border: solid 1px #323849;}/*RSS page style */.textbox {	border: solid 1px #323849;	font-family: Lucida Grande, Arial, Helvetica, sans-serif;	font-size: 13px;	color: #f5f5fb;	line-height: 22px;	padding:25px;}.footer {	font-family: Lucida Grande, Lucida Sans Unicode, Lucida Sans, Trebuchet MS, Arial, Helvetica,sans-serif;	font-size: 10px;	line-height: 16px;	color: white;}.navigationfooter {	border-top: solid 1px #323849;	border-bottom: solid 1px #323849;	font-family: Lucida Grande, Lucida Sans Unicode, Lucida Sans, Verdana, Arial,Helvetica,sans-serif;	font-size: .72em;	line-height: 1.3em;	color: white	padding-top: 7px;	padding-bottom: 7px;}.catalogfooter {	font-family: Lucida Grande, Arial, Helvetica, Helvetica Neue, sans-serif;	font-size: .72em;	line-height: 1em;	color: #fafaf5;	padding-left: 10px;	padding-right: 15px;}/*for the WAP page */.footerwap {	font-family: Lucida Grande, Lucida Sans Unicode, Lucida Sans, Trebuchet MS, Arial, Helvetica,sans-serif;	font-size: 10px;	line-height: 16px;	color: black;}a.wap:link 		{ color:#0B0B48; }a.wap:active 	{ color:#0B0B48; }a.wap:visited 	{ color:#979797; }/* regular textual funk */.navigation {	font-family: Lucida Grande,Arial,Helvetica,sans-serif;	font-size: 14px;	line-height: 20px;	color: white}.text {	font-family: Lucida Grande, Arial, Helvetica, sans-serif;	font-size: 13px;	color: #f5f5fb;	line-height: 22px;	padding-top: 8px;	padding-left: 15px;	padding-right: 15px;	}.captionmaintitle {	font-family: Lucida Grande,Arial,Helvetica,sans-serif;	font-size: 18px;	line-height: 28px;	color: #0d0d0d;	font-weight: bold;}.captionmaintext {	font-family: Lucida Grande,Arial,Helvetica,sans-serif;	font-size: 12px;	line-height: 18px;	color: white;	font-weight: normal;}.fullcaption {	font-family: Verdana, Lucida Grande, Arial, Helvetica, Verdana, sans-serif;	font-size: 13px;	color: #0d0d0d;	line-height: 16px;}.standard {	font-family: Lucida Grande,Verdana, Trebuchet MS, Trebuchet, Verdana, Arial,Helvetica,sans-serif;	font-size: 9px;	line-height: 15px;	color: #000000;}.credit {	font-family: Lucida Grande,Verdana, Arial,Helvetica,sans-serif;	font-size: 9px;	line-height: 13px;	color: white;	padding-left: 3px;}/*This is a lot of old stuff that I need to eventually weed out *//* begin styles for UA style banner */#header_top { background-color: #0d0d0d; min-height: 65px; }#header_top ul {line-height: 3em; text-align: right; padding-right: 25px; }/* adjust padding of this object to move closer or farther from the page edges. */#header_top li { display: inline; font-size: 1.09em; border-right: 1px solid #FFF; padding: .35em .5em;  }#header_top li a { color: white; text-decoration: none; font-weight: bold; }#header_top li .hover { color: white; text-decoration: underline; font-weight: bold; }.one_liner { padding-left: 10px; line-height: 3em; }.simple	{ padding-left: 30px; float: left; }/* adjusts padding of the UA one liner graphic, "content_one_line.gif", in header to move closer or farther from the page edges. */#header_top .no_bor { border: 0px; }/* add this class to <li> tags that contain items that DO NOT get borders inside the #header_top <div>. */#header_top ul .search_btn { margin-left: -7px; position: relative; Top: 5px; }/* this style adjusts the position of the search button graphic, "", in the header */#header_top .search { font-size: 9px; color: #333; background-color:#EEE; border-style: solid; border-width:1px; width:70px; height:13px; -moz-border-radius: 5px; margin-bottom: 2px; }/* this style adjusts the height and width of the search box in the header. the "-moz-border-radius: 5px;" adds rounded corners to the box *//* header_bottom -- lower "blue" part of the header. */#header_bottom { background-color: #790000; border-bottom: 1px solid #FFF; border-top: 1px solid #FFF; height: 30px; margin-bottom: 1px; }#header_bottom ul {line-height: 3em; text-align: left; padding-left: 5px; font-family: Lucida Grande, Verdana, Helvetica, sans-serif; font-size: 9px; }/* adjust padding of this object to move closer or farther from the page edges. */#header_bottom li { display: inline; font-size: 1.05em; border-right: 1px solid #FFF; padding: .35em .5em; position: middle; }#header_bottom li a { color: white; text-decoration: none; font-style: normal; }#header_bottom .no_bor { border: 0px; }.drop_shadow  { background-image: url(http://homepage.mac.com/yespinoza/graphix/content_bg.gif); margin-top: 1px; width: 100%; height: 15px }/* be sure to update the link to the graphic above *//* begin top-level styles */* { margin: 0; padding: 10; }
